I strongly believe in the power of music (especially calming music) to get a scholar in the zone. Throughout my 3 classes of 28 students each with an array of needs, abilities, and language proficiencies, it will be so helpful to turn students to their (previously sanitized) headphones and our class study playlist when it comes time for them to be released to do independent work - especially when that work is writing. As I circulate the room working (and talking) to students 1 on 1 or in small groups, I don't those conversations to inhibit the thought or workflow of another student. I love the sound of a class full of eager student voices, and I encourage that sound often. However, I also love the sound of a quiet room, filled with those same students who are focused and working intently and creatively to show me what they know.
